Comparison of Nd:YAG Ceramic Laser Pumped at 885nm and 808nm
Authors:ZONG Nan  ZHANG Xiao-Fu  MA Qing-Lei  WANG Bao-Shan  CUI Da-Fu  PENG Qin-Jun  XU Zu-Yan  PAN Yu-Bai  FENG Xi-Qi
Institution:Laboratory of Optical Physics, Institute of Physics, Chinese Academy of Science, Beijing 100190Graduate School of the Chinese Academy of Sciences, Beijing 100190Technical Institute of Physics and Chemistry, Chinese Academy of Sciences, Beijing 100190Shanghai Institute of Ceramics, Chinese Academy of Sciences, Shanghai 201800
Abstract:Laser performance of 1064nm domestic Nd:YAG ceramic lasers for 885nm direct pumping and 808nm traditional pumping are compared. Higher slope efficiency of 34% and maximum output power of 16.5W are obtained for the 885nm pump with a 6mm length 1at.% Nd:YAG ceramic. The advantages for 885nm direct pumping are discussed in detail. This pumping scheme for highly doping a Nd:YAG ceramic laser is considered as an available way to generate high power and good beam quality simultaneously.
